BioTechnica Fest: Where Science and Creativity Converge to Shape the Future.

My journey began at the Levin Lab, where exploring bioelectricity and regenerative medicine deepened my curiosity for science. I soon realized a larger issue: the public's lack of bioscience knowledge and the U.S. falling behind in biotech, especially compared to China. Determined to bridge this gap, I conceived BioTechnica Fest, a dynamic event merging science with pop culture to reignite interest in STEM and empower young African American men, driving the U.S. toward global biotech leadership.
Learning Outcomes:
Through BioTechnica Fest, I honed my expertise in futures thinking, using tools like futures wheels, STEEPX reports, SWOTs, and competitive audits to anticipate industry trends. I conducted over 15 in-depth interviews to understand my target demographic's needs, leading to a brand strategy that truly resonates. This hands-on approach sharpened my ability to blend research with creative strategy, resulting in a well-rounded and impactful final product.
